College for Creative Studies

STUDENT ABSENCE POLICY

Unexcused Absences

Each 3-hour meeting of a class is considered a class session. Attendance is taken at the beginning of each class session.

Students who arrive 5 to 20 minutes late for any class session are considered tardy. Three (3) tardies equal one (1) unexcused absence.

Arriving more than 20 minutes late, or missing an entire 3-hour session is considered a full absence. This applies to all classes, whether they meet for 6 hours on the same day, or on 2 different days of the week, or for one
3-hour period per week. Students who miss both sessions of a class which meets for 6 hours in a day will incur 2 absences. Each meeting of the Foundation lecture classes is also considered a full session.

Three (3) unexcused absences equal the reduction of one whole grade from the earned grade. Four (4) unexcused absences equal failure in the course.

For all classes meeting in 5-week segments, 2 absences in any 5-week period will result in failure.

Excused Absences

An absence may be excused if there is a medical reason, family emergency or extenuating circumstances beyond the student's control. Students seeking an excused absence may bring their documentation to the Academic Advising Center, 2nd floor of the Yamasaki Building. The Advising Center will send a written notice to the student's instructors, advisor, and department.
